**Runbook — Queuewarden autoscaler**

Scope: consumer fleet behind the Fennick ingest queue. Trigger: depth > 50k for 3 min. Action: Queuewarden scales consumers 2x, caps at 40 pods. If depth keeps climbing, check for poison messages before scaling further — manual scale beyond the cap needs lead sign-off. Flapping usually means cooldown is too short; bump to 10 min. For the sync: last validated against the build token noted below.

build token for fahof-bajeg: htk21_52cf70d0bac7ab8bd3bc3

Quick runbook note for whoever reviews the Liftwright simulator changes: the elevator-dispatch sim now seeds car positions from the scenario file instead of randomizing, so runs are reproducible. If dispatch latency looks weird, check that the hall-call generator isn't still on the old Poisson config — that bit trips everyone up. Run the smoke scenario twice and diff the outputs; they should match exactly. When filing a review comment about a mismatch, include the sim build token shown below.

pipeline stamp: htk3_69f

Heads up, future maintainers: the nightly fleet fuel-usage report from Tankmetric stopped generating last Tuesday because the service credential quietly expired. Nobody noticed until the ops team at the Bramford depot asked where their numbers went. The cron job swallows auth errors, which is lousy — there's a follow-up ticket to make it page instead. I've rotated the credential and re-ran the last five nights successfully. For reference while we migrate to the vault-based flow, the new key is below.

service key, fawip-bajef: kto11_Qt5wZK9vdNC

// Initializes the shared client for Wickfield's reporting DB.
// We route through the Pondside pooler: max 15 connections per
// instance, 30s idle timeout, statements must release promptly.
// Do not open raw connections here; the pooler handles failover.
// The pooler authenticates requests with the service key below.

gateway credential: kto23_LX9A4ys6i4nzHtpOLNLodKK